When you finally find the funds and muster up the guts to take that long-awaited trip to a faraway land, some travelers depend on guidebooks to prepare them for their adventure of a lifetime. Although these books are chockfull of useful information, history and practical tips, once you’re on the ground in your destination, they can become a bit of a distraction. Spending your time buried in the pages of your guidebook takes your focus away from the beauty and novelty that surrounds. Instead of relying on a book, hire a local guide for your next trip.

 

Local guides do not parade around with large signs advertising their services, like some free tour companies do in major cities. Instead, you will have to do your research to find the guide who is right for you. Sites like GuideAdvisor aid you in your search for the perfect guide by suggesting questions for your guide before you hire him or her, such as languages spoken, prices for services and possible itineraries.

 

These guides were typically born and raised in the region and know hidden secrets of which the guidebook and public tours may not be aware. By exploring the area with a local guide, you’ll be able to learn proper etiquette, pick up a few key phrases in the local language and ask every and any question you have throughout your journey. You may even be invited to a dinner at a local’s house where you’ll have a front row seat to the customs and norms of your locale. For cultural authenticity and an unforgettable experience, local is the way to go.
